Museum
The , is a history museum specialized on the life of Suharto, the former second president of and a powerful political figure in modern Indonesian history. is situated 3½ km northeast of Pule.

Tandjong West was a particuliere land or private domain in modern-day , Jagakarsa, , . The center of the domain was the eponymous Landhuis Tandjong West, an eighteenth-century Dutch colonial manor house.
